Because the machinery and equipment appraiser does not visit the site of the equipment being appraised, a desktop machinery and equipment appraisal requires the client to provide the appraiser with all the necessary information for each of the items to be appraised, such as photos, make, model, hours, mileage, years, and original cost. The appraiser then performs an appraisal from his or her desk, as the name implies, based on all the information provided by the client.
